A total of 69 earthquakes with a magnitude of four or above have struck within 300 km (186 mi) of France in the past 10 years. This comes down to a yearly average of 6 earthquakes per year

A relatively large number of earthquakes occurred near France in 2016. A total of 11 earthquakes (mag 4+) were detected within 300 km of France that year. The strongest had a 4.4 magnitude.

The strongest recent earthquake of the past 10 years near France occurred on Nov 5, 2014 17:19 local time (Europe/Paris timezone). It had a magnitude of 5 and struck 41 kilometers (25 mi) north-northwest of Rouen, at a depth of 2 km. Discover more strong earthquakes near France in the list below.

A longer time ago, a MAG-6.3 earthquake struck on Sep 7, 1920 06:55, 254 kilometers (158 mi) north-northwest of Nice. It is the strongest earthquake near France in the past 124 years (Our data goes back to January 1st, 1900).
